Mulligan: a second chance; in a game, happens when a player gets a second chance to perform a certain move or action. An unpenalized chance to re-take a stroke that went awry.

I remember seeing the movie "Groundhog Day" in the theater the year it came out. It's one of my all time favorite movies. It made we wish for two things simultaneously. The first was that I could have a magical 6 weeks to learn the piano or a foreign language or whatever without having to worry about daily responsibilities. The second was for an annual cosmic mulligan every February 2nd. Basically, you would get a free do-over of whatever idiotic thing you did in the past year.

I'm not exactly sure what I would do over each year, but I'm sure there'd be something. Maybe it would be something little like forgetting to check to make sure I was hitting the 'forward' button instead of the 'reply' to button before making some snarky comment on an email. Doh! (yes, I've actually done that one with a former boss but she thought it was funny.) or maybe it would be packing lighter so my luggage doesn't get fined or remembering to get my car serviced before the transmission goes. You get the idea...

Everyone has some sort of regret that they wish they could remedy. Wouldn't a cosmic mulligan be a good solution?
